SIGNAL-ACTIVATED LINGERIE
A lingerie comprises a panel, a first and second strap, and a signal-activated fastener. The first and second straps are coupled via the signal-activated fastener which is housed inside a housing. The signal-activated fastener unfastens when it receives a signal, causing the housing to decouple from the end of one of the straps and pulling the entire lingerie with it so that the lingerie falls off from the wearer's body.
1 . A lingerie comprising:
(a) a panel that covers one or more areas of a wearer's body, said panel including a first panel-end and a second panel-end;
(b) a first strap including a first first-strap-end and a second first-strap-end, wherein the first first-strap-end is coupled with the first panel-end;
(c) a second strap including a first second-strap-end and a second second-strap-end, wherein the first second-strap-end is coupled with the second panel-end; and
(d) a housing that houses a signal-activated fastener, said housing including a first housing-end and a second housing-end, wherein the first housing-end is coupled with the second first-strap-end and the second housing-end is coupled with the second second-strap-end;
wherein the signal-activated fastener is responsive to a signal and operative to unfasten causing the housing to decouple from one of the second first-strap-end and second second-strap-end, and wherein the weight of the housing due to gravity causes the lingerie to fall off from the wearer's body.
2 . The lingerie of claim 1 , wherein the lingerie is one of a bra, a panties, and a combination thereof.
3 . The lingerie of claim 1 , wherein at least one of the first strap and second strap comprises elastic material, wherein by coupling the housing with the second first-strap-end and second second-strap-end the elastic material is stretched, and wherein by unfastening the signal-activated fastener, the strain energy associated with the stretched elastic material further causes the lingerie to fall off from the wearer's body.
4 . The lingerie of claim 1 , wherein the housing comprises a spherical shape.
5 . The lingerie of claim 1 , wherein the one of the second first-strap-end and second second-strap-end comprises a ferrous component, and wherein the signal-activated fastener comprises:
(a) a sensor capable of sensing pressure waves generated by a person clapping his/her hands and operative to generate an electrical signal;
(b) a controller responsive to the electrical signal and operative to generate a control signal; and
(c) an electromagnet magnetically coupled with the ferrous component thereby fastening the lingerie;
wherein the electromagnet is responsive to the control signal and operative to demagnetize thereby decoupling from the ferrous component.
6 . The lingerie of claim 5 , wherein the sensor is a microphone.
7 . The lingerie of claim 5 , wherein the controller is a microprocessor.
8 . The lingerie of claim 5 , wherein the controller generates the control signal upon verifying that the electrical signal comprises two consecutive claps within a predetermined time interval.
9 . The lingerie of claim 5 , wherein the controller generates the control signal upon verifying that the electrical signal comprises a single clap including a predetermined amplitude.
10 . The lingerie of claim 5 , wherein the sensor is a voice biometric sensor capable of sensing voice of a person and operative to generate an electrical signal.
11 . The lingerie of claim 10 , wherein the controller generates the control signal upon verifying that the electrical signal substantially matches a predetermined signal.
12 . The lingerie of claim 11 , wherein the predetermined signal is at least one of a password, a phrase, and a combination thereof.
13 . The lingerie of claim 5 , wherein the sensor comprises at least one of a biometric sensor, pressure sensor, and optical sensor.
